AI-based detection is becoming a hot topic in cybersecurity, and comparing solutions like Darktrace and Zscaler can be tricky. From my research, I’ve learned that these two providers take different approaches to threat detection. Darktrace is known for its self-learning technology, which adapts to your network’s behavior over time, making it quite effective at spotting anomalies. Zscaler, however, focuses on secure internet access, providing a different layer of protection by monitoring traffic before it even reaches your network. What Is AI-Based Detection: Darktrace vs Zscaler?
AI-based detection is a way to spot threats in computer systems using smart technology. It looks at patterns and behaviors to find things that could be harmful. Darktrace and Zscaler are two different approaches to this. Darktrace focuses on understanding normal behavior in a network, while Zscaler emphasizes secure access to applications and data. Both aim to keep our digital world safe, but they do it in their own unique ways.
In simple terms, think of AI-based detection like having a digital watchdog. It helps us stay alert for anything suspicious, whether it’s a strange login or unusual data traffic. Common Mistakes and Myths
Many people think that AI detection is foolproof. They believe that once you set it up, you can just sit back and relax. However, that’s not true. AI needs regular updates and human oversight to stay effective. Ignoring this can lead to missed threats.
Another common myth is that AI can replace human expertise entirely. While AI can analyze data quickly, it still lacks the intuition and experience that a human brings. It’s best used as a tool to support analysts, not replace them.
